TECH TRAVELS TO ARKANSAS-MONTICELLO THURSDAY, HOSTS OUACHITA SATURDAY

RUSSELLVILLE, Ark. - The Arkansas Tech Golden Suns continue play in the Great American Conference this weekend, as Tech travels to Arkansas-Monticello on Thursday before hosting Ouachita on Saturday. The Suns take on the Cotton Blossoms in Monticello at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day, Jan. 18. Tech battles the Lady Tigers in Russellville at 1 p.m. on Saturday.

ALL-TIME SERIES

In 86 all-time meetings between Arkansas Tech and Arkansas-Monticello, Tech leads the series 62-24. The Golden Suns have won 19 consecutive and 24 out of the last 25 games over UAM.

Arkansas Tech leads the all-time series against Ouachita, 57-14. The Suns have won eight straight games against the Lady Tigers, including two wins last season, by an average of 19 points. 

SCOUTING THE GOLDEN SUNS

Arkansas Tech (11-2, 7-2 GAC) currently sits second in the GAC standings, two games behind No. 13 Southwestern Oklahoma. After falling to Henderson State in Arkadelphia, the Golden Suns have bounced back with wins over Southern Arkansas and Harding.

Tech boasts the 13th-best scoring offense in Division II, averaging 80.9 points per game. The Suns have beaten their opponents by an average of 15.3 points per game this season, 29th-best scoring margin in the country. Arkansas Tech has been dominant inside, averaging 46.3 rebounds per game, which ranks seventh in Division II and also averaging 17.0 offensive rebounds per game which ranks ninth in the country. The Suns also lead the GAC and rank 16th in Division II with 12.1 steals per game. 

Jayana Sanders leads the Suns with 15.4 points per game, and she is coming off her fourth 20-point performance of the season. Lyrik Williams, is ranked first in the GAC in offensive rebounds per game (3.9) and second in rebounds (9.1). Cheyenne North ranks 20th in Division II and second in the conference with 2.54 blocks per game, Kylie Ladd is fourth in the country and leads the GAC with 3.3 steals per contest. 

SCOUTING THE COTTON BLOSSOMS

Arkansas-Monticello (5-8, 1-7 GAC) has lost its previous four games and six of its last seven. The Cotton Blossoms lone conference victory came against Oklahoma Baptist (74-66). UAM is currently ranked last in the GAC standings.

The Cotton Blossoms are ranked first in the conference in scoring defense (63.4), second in steals per game (9.8), third in turnover margin (+2.85) and fourth in 3-point field goal percentage defense (.316). Brittnee Broadway and Charlynn Perry pace the UAM offense. Broadway is ranked ninth in the GAC in assists per game (3.0) and 17th in scoring (12.2), while Perry ranks eighth in the conference in made 3-point field goals per game (2.3), ninth in 3-point field goal percentage (.390) and 19th in scoring (11.6).

SCOUTING THE LADY TIGERS

Ouachita (8-6, 4-4 GAC) had won back-to-back conference matchups over East Central and Arkansas-Monticello, before falling to Harding on Saturday. The Lady Tigers are scheduled to face Southern Arkansas on Thursday before traveling to Russellville on Saturday. 

OUA averages 68.3 points per game while allowing 66.5 points per game. Ouachita ranks third in the conference in scoring defense (65.6) and field goal percentage defense (.378), while ranking fifth in blocked shots per game (3.5) and sixth in defensive rebounds (27.5). Taylor Bowles leads Ouachita in scoring with 11.7 points per game, while Morgan Miller ranks second in the GAC in field goal percentage (.551) and fourth 3-point field goal percentage (.475).
